Pastoral Visitation
Clergy and our Parish Nurse, Ms. Kathy Mallory, are available for hosptial visitation when the church is notified. State and Federal confidentiality laws make it impossible for clergy to know whether one has been hospitalized. Please call the office to let us know the name of the hospital at which you are staying, and room number, in order to receive this healing ministry of prayer, with holy oil and pastoral care.
